Understanding Court Appearances

Court appearances are formal proceedings where individuals involved in a legal case present their arguments, evidence, and testimonies before a judge or jury. These appearances can vary widely depending on the type of case, the stage of the legal process, and the jurisdiction. Common types of court appearances include:

  • Arraignments: Where defendants are formally charged and enter a plea.
  • Pre-trial hearings: Where legal issues are resolved before the trial begins.
  • Trial: Where the case is presented to a judge or jury for a decision.
  • Sentencing hearings: Where the judge determines the punishment for a convicted defendant.

Each of these appearances requires a different level of preparation and understanding of legal procedures. Court Appearance Professionals play a crucial role in guiding individuals through these complex processes.

Preparing for a Court Appearance

Preparing for a court appearance involves several steps, each crucial for a successful outcome. Here is a comprehensive guide to help you get ready:

Gather All Necessary Documents

Ensure you have all the relevant documents and evidence ready. This may include:

  • Legal documents related to your case.
  • Witness statements and affidavits.
  • Photographs, videos, or other forms of evidence.
  • Any correspondence related to the case.

Your Court Appearance Professional can help you organize these documents and ensure they are presented effectively in court.

Understand the Court Procedures

Familiarize yourself with the court procedures and etiquette. This includes:

  • Dressing appropriately for court.
  • Knowing when to stand, sit, and speak.
  • Understanding the roles of the judge, jury, and other court officials.

Your Court Appearance Professional can provide guidance on these procedures and ensure you are comfortable and confident in the courtroom.

Practice Your Testimony

If you are a witness or the defendant, practicing your testimony is crucial. This involves:

  • Rehearsing your answers to potential questions.
  • Staying calm and composed under pressure.
  • Being honest and straightforward in your responses.

Your Court Appearance Professional can conduct mock trials and provide feedback to help you refine your testimony.

Stay Organized and On Time

Being organized and punctual is essential for a successful court appearance. This includes:

  • Arriving at the court early.
  • Bringing all necessary documents and evidence.
  • Following the court's schedule and instructions.

Your Court Appearance Professional can help you stay on track and ensure that all necessary preparations are completed.

📝 Note: Always double-check the court's requirements and deadlines to avoid any last-minute surprises.
